Form\u00fcl, bile\u015fikteki g\u00f6receli atom veya iyon say\u0131s\u0131n\u0131 g\u00f6sterir ve bile\u015fiminin kolay tan\u0131mlanmas\u0131na ve temsil edilmesine olanak tan\u0131r.<\/p>\n<p> NaCl&#8217;nin molar k\u00fctlesi<\/p>\n<p> Sofra tuzu olarak da adland\u0131r\u0131lan sodyum klor\u00fcr\u00fcn molar k\u00fctlesi 58,44 g\/mol&#8217;d\u00fcr. Bu, bir mol sodyum klor\u00fcr\u00fcn 58.44 gram bile\u015fik i\u00e7erdi\u011fi anlam\u0131na gelir. Molar k\u00fctle, bile\u015fikteki s\u0131ras\u0131yla 22,99 g\/mol ve 35,45 g\/mol olan sodyum (Na) ve klorin (Cl) atomik k\u00fctlelerinin eklenmesiyle hesaplan\u0131r.<\/p>\n<h6 class=\"wp-block-heading\"> Sodyum klor\u00fcr\u00fcn kaynama noktas\u0131<\/h6>\n<p> Sodyum klor\u00fcr, iyonik ba\u011f\u0131 nedeniyle 1,413 \u00b0C (2,575 \u00b0F) gibi y\u00fcksek bir kaynama noktas\u0131na sahiptir. Sodyum klor\u00fcr geleneksel anlamda bir molek\u00fcl olarak mevcut olmasa da, molek\u00fcl a\u011f\u0131rl\u0131\u011f\u0131 NaCl form\u00fcl birimine g\u00f6re hesaplan\u0131r. <\/p>\n<div class=\"wp-block-image\">\n<figure class=\"alignright size-large is-resized\"><img decoding=\"async\" loading=\"lazy\" src=\"https:\/\/chemuza.org\/wp-content\/uploads\/2023\/08\/nacl.jpg\" alt=\"NaCl\" width=\"206\" height=\"74\" srcset=\"\" sizes=\"\"><\/figure>\n<\/div>\n<h6 class=\"wp-block-heading\"> Sodyum klor\u00fcr\u00fcn yap\u0131s\u0131<\/h6>\n<p> Sodyum klor\u00fcr, sodyum ve klor\u00fcr iyonlar\u0131n\u0131n 1:1 oran\u0131nda d\u00fczenli dizili\u015finden olu\u015fan bir kristal yap\u0131ya sahiptir. Yap\u0131, her bir sodyum iyonunun alt\u0131 klor\u00fcr iyonu ve her bir klor\u00fcr iyonunun alt\u0131 sodyum iyonu ile \u00e7evrelendi\u011fi, y\u00fcz merkezli bir k\u00fcbik kafestir. Sodyum klor\u00fcrdeki iyonik ba\u011f, \u00e7ok kararl\u0131 ve k\u0131r\u0131lmas\u0131 zor bir a\u011f yap\u0131s\u0131yla sonu\u00e7lan\u0131r.<\/p>\n<figure class=\"wp-block-table\">\n<table>\n<tbody>\n<tr>\n<td> D\u0131\u015f g\u00f6r\u00fcn\u00fc\u015f<\/td>\n<td> Beyaz kristal kat\u0131<\/td>\n<\/tr>\n<tr>\n<td> Spesifik yer \u00e7ekimi<\/td>\n<td> 2.165<\/td>\n<\/tr>\n<tr>\n<td> Renk<\/td>\n<td> Renksiz<\/td>\n<\/tr>\n<tr>\n<td> Koku<\/td>\n<td> Kokusuz<\/td>\n<\/tr>\n<tr>\n<td> Molar k\u00fctle<\/td>\n<td> 58,44 gr\/mol<\/td>\n<\/tr>\n<tr>\n<td> Yo\u011funluk<\/td>\n<td> 2,165 gr\/ml<\/td>\n<\/tr>\n<tr>\n<td> F\u00fczyon noktas\u0131<\/td>\n<td> 801\u00b0C (1474\u00b0F)<\/td>\n<\/tr>\n<tr>\n<td> Kaynama noktas\u0131<\/td>\n<td> 1.413\u00b0C (2.575\u00b0F)<\/td>\n<\/tr>\n<tr>\n<td> Fla\u015f noktas\u0131<\/td>\n<td> Uygulanamaz<\/td>\n<\/tr>\n<tr>\n<td> sudaki \u00e7\u00f6z\u00fcn\u00fcrl\u00fck<\/td>\n<td> 20\u00b0C&#8217;de 359 g\/L<\/td>\n<\/tr>\n<tr>\n<td> \u00e7\u00f6z\u00fcn\u00fcrl\u00fck<\/td>\n<td> Suda ve gliserolde \u00e7\u00f6z\u00fcn\u00fcr; etanol ve asetonda \u00e7\u00f6z\u00fcnmez<\/td>\n<\/tr>\n<tr>\n<td> Buhar bas\u0131nc\u0131<\/td>\n<td> \u0130hmal edilebilir<\/td>\n<\/tr>\n<tr>\n<td> Buhar yo\u011funlu\u011fu<\/td>\n<td> Uygulanamaz<\/td>\n<\/tr>\n<tr>\n<td> pKa<\/td>\n<td> 7<\/td>\n<\/tr>\n<tr>\n<td> pH<\/td>\n<td> 7 (n\u00f6tr)<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/figure>\n<h5 class=\"wp-block-heading\"> <strong>Sodyum klor\u00fcr\u00fcn g\u00fcvenli\u011fi ve tehlikeleri<\/strong><\/h5>\n<p> Sodyum klor\u00fcr (NaCl) genellikle insan t\u00fcketimi ve kullan\u0131m\u0131 i\u00e7in g\u00fcvenli kabul edilir. Bu reaksiyon, yan \u00fcr\u00fcnler olarak sodyum klor\u00fcr ve su \u00fcretir. Bu reaksiyonun denklemi \u015f\u00f6yledir:<\/p>\n<p> HCl + NaOH \u2192 NaCl + H2O<\/p>\n<p> Ba\u015fka bir y\u00f6ntem, sodyum karbonat\u0131n (Na2CO3) hidroklorik asit (HCl) ile reaksiyona sokularak sodyum klor\u00fcr, karbon dioksit ve su \u00fcretilmesini i\u00e7erir. Bu reaksiyonun denklemi \u015f\u00f6yledir:<\/p>\n<p> 2HCl + Na2CO3 \u2192 2NaCl + CO2 + H2O<\/p>\n<p> Sodyum ve klor gaz\u0131 aras\u0131ndaki reaksiyon, sodyum klor\u00fcr\u00fcn sentezlenmesine y\u00f6nelik bu t\u00fcr y\u00f6ntemlerden biridir. Bu reaksiyon, istenmeyen yan \u00fcr\u00fcnlerin olu\u015fumunu \u00f6nlemek i\u00e7in y\u00fcksek s\u0131cakl\u0131klar ve dikkatli kontrol gerektirir. Bu reaksiyonun denklemi \u015f\u00f6yledir:<\/p>\n<p> 2Na + Cl2 \u2192 2NaCl<\/p>\n<p> Kimyac\u0131lar, maliyet, reaktiflerin mevcudiyeti ve nihai \u00fcr\u00fcn\u00fcn istenen safl\u0131\u011f\u0131 ve verimi gibi fakt\u00f6rlere dayal\u0131 olarak sodyum klor\u00fcr sentez y\u00f6ntemlerini de\u011fi\u015ftirmeyi veya \u00e7e\u015fitlendirmeyi se\u00e7ebilirler. Bu y\u00f6ntemler, do\u011fal kaynaklar nadir olsa bile sodyum klor\u00fcr \u00fcretimini sa\u011flar.<\/p>\n<h5 class=\"wp-block-heading\"> <strong>Sodyum klor\u00fcr\u00fcn kullan\u0131m alanlar\u0131<\/strong><\/h5>\n<p> Sofra tuzu olarak da bilinen sodyum klor\u00fcr\u00fcn \u00e7e\u015fitli end\u00fcstrilerde ve uygulamalarda bir\u00e7ok kullan\u0131m\u0131 vard\u0131r.
